Jim Christopulos' film documenting the VdGG show at the Beacon, NYC, '76 goes online tonight. This marries newly found footage with audio and together with stills, eyewitness testimony and reminiscence it paints a graphic picture of the event.
www.youtube.com/watch?v=1gPT... from 18.00 UK time.

Some pretty major news.
On 26th Spetember Universal are putting out a Box Set: "Peter Hammill - the Charisma and Virgin recordings 1971-86".
This brings together all my early albums in an 18 cd, 2 blu-ray collection. Really quite a thing!
More info, including pre-order links, at Sofasound.com

Ok, here's something fairly extraordinary. Recently found 8mm footage has been married up with audio and it's now possible to see/hear 12 mins of VdGG at Massey Hall Toronto '76. Respect to Jim Christopolus for doing this.
Enjoy: youtu.be/8y-NOSMG22c
